Hi
I've recently installed Internet Explorer 9.
The option to enable inprivate filtering is not present in the safety menu.
I've searched in google, and I can't find any news that this feature has been removed, so I assume I've got something wrong with the way ie9 has installed.
I've set the FilteringMode option to 1 in the registry entry
HKEY_CURRENT_USER\Software\Microsoft\Internet Explorer\Safety\PrivacIE
Nothing happens.
This is true for the 32-bit and 64-bit versions on my machine.
Anyone have any ideas?
